    Talking Love my Mirage!

    Hi! Just drove my Mirage 1.2L ES CVT for the first time in heavy snow. This car is absolutely GREAT for snow covered roads. The car pulls straight under acceleration and feels very stable. Ive had the car almost a week now and so far love it. I drive 48 miles to work each day and this car drives and feels better than my Honda Fit that I traded in. Thumbs up from me for the navigation's nice big screen, and the climate control, the car warms up really fast and is ready to go quickly. Having the remote start installed Monday can't wait! Wow also love the FAST key too, always had key access to my cars and think this is great key fob stays in my pocket no more fumbling for keys. Out!
